Transaction 4e76dc82fa136520e6348db76d310aaaf657158e44c2d3019d3764a1384f5431
1 Input
1 Output
-
4e76dc82fa136520e6348db76d310aaaf657158e44c2d3019d3764a1384f5431:0
- value
- 3978617
- script pubkey
- OP_0 OP_PUSHBYTES_20 a848af9e8abf2c5632a1b2b53aa0d2b098a2de27
- address
- bc1q4py2l852huk9vv4pk26n4gxjkzv29h38r3w2vj